M044 - INSTRUCTION MANUAL 5
6. From the geographical bearing, calculate the magnetic bearing of the aircraft: The variation (Var) depends
on the current location, which can be determined from an aviation chart.
Ex. Geographical bearing: 30°
Variation (Var): 10°
Magnetic bearing: 30° + 10° = 40°
Tn: True North | Mn: Magnetic North | Var: Variation
If the variation (Var) is to the West, it is added to
the geographical bearing to obtain the magnetic
bearing. Ex. 30° + 10° = 40°
If the variation (Var) is to the East, it is subtracted from
the geographical bearing to obtain the magnetic
bearing. Ex. 30° – 15° = 15°
7. Calculation of crosswind angle.
Ex. Wind direction: 70°
Magnetic bearing of aircraft: 40°
Crosswind angle: 70° – 40° = 30° (headwind)
